25 men can consume 250kg of wheat in 20 days. 20 men cang consume how much wheat in 25 days?

Explanation
The consumption rate is 250 kg ÷ (25 men x 20 days) = 250 kg ÷ 500 man-days = 0.5 kg per man-day. Therefore, 20 men consume 20 x 25 x 0.5 kg = 250 kg in 25 days. The likely mistaken answer is 200 kg, which fails to adjust correctly for both the new number of men and the new duration.

About Ratio and Proportion
Ratios compare quantities in the same units, while proportions state that two ratios are equal. Problems cover simplification, division in a given ratio, direct and inverse variation, scale, and missing terms, with attention to the difference between a ratio and a fraction representing part of a whole.
